This week the NCAA brought us a handful of great games and equally great footwear choices. The usual list toppers of Miami and Duke make this week's cut but they do fall to the Trojan's of USC. While Miami's Shane Larkin may have worn the best sneaker, in relation to his team's jerseys, out of all NCAA players this week in the "Weatherman" Nike Zoom KD IV the Trojan's brought out great sneakers as a whole. 10. Syracuse Orange
Team: Syracuse Orange
Players: Brandon Triche, Jerami Grant
The Syracuse Orange's Brandon Triche laced up a Nike Kobe 8 iD while his teammate, Jerami Grant wore the "Cool Grey" Air Jordan XII.
9. Florida State Seminoles
Team: Florida State Seminoles
Players: Okaro White, Ian Miller
The Florida State Seminoles' Okaro White wore a classic Nike Air Penny III this week while his teammate, Ian Miller, laced up the "Canary" Nike LeBron X.
8. Wake Forest Demon Deacons
Team: Wake Forest Demon Deacons
Players: Devin Thomas, C.J. Harris
The Wake Forest Demon Deacons' Devin Thomas and C.J. Harris both opted for Chris Paul's signature sneakers this week and laced up Jordan CP3.V and CP3.VI PEs.
7. Arkansas Razorbacks
Team: Arkansas Razorbacks
Players: Mardracus Wade
The Arkansas Razorbacks' Mardracus Wade hit the court in the white/varisty Air Jordan XII while his teammate, Coty Wade, wore the "Year of the Snake" Nike Zoom Huarache 2K4.
6. Missouri Tigers
Team: Missouri Tigers
Players: Laurence Bowers, Tony Criswell
The Missouri Tigers' Laurence Bowers laced up the "Golden Moments" Air Jordan VI and Tony Criswell wore a Jordan CP3.VI PE.
5. UNLV Runnin' Rebels
Team: UNLV Runnin' Rebels
Players: Anthony Marshall, Bryce Dejean-Jones, Anthony Bennett
The UNLV Runnin' Rebels' Anthony Marshall and Bryce Dejean-Jones both laced up classic Jordan Brand models in the "Bred" Air Jordan XI and "Chicago" Air Jordan X while Anthony Bennett too to the court in the "Carbon" Nike LeBron X.
4. UNC Tar Heels
Team: UNC Tar Heels
Players: Marcus Paige, James Michael McAdoo
The UNC Tar Heels' Marcus Paige and James Michael McAdoo both took to the court in Jordan Brand PEs this week. Paige wore a Jordan CP3.VI PE while McAdoo laced up a Jordan Aero Flight PE.
3. Duke Blue Devils
Team: Duke Blue Devils
Players: Mason Plumlee, Seth Curry
Duke's Mason Plumlee and Seth Curry took to the court this week, once again, in Nike LeBron X iDs.
2. Miami Hurricanes
Team: Miami Hurricanes
Players: Shane Larkin, Kenny Kadji, Trey McKinney-Jones
This week the Hurricanes of Miami took to the court in some great footwear. The 'Canes Shane Larkin laced up the "Weatherman" Nike Zoom KD IV while Trey McKinney-Jones opted for KD's latest model, the "DMV" Nike KD V. F-C Kenny Kadji also chose to wear a Nike signature model and chose a Nike LeBron X iD.
1. USC Trojans
Team: USC Trojans
Players: Byron Wesley, Dewayne Dedmon, J.T. Terrell
The USC Trojans take the number one spot this week as a handful of players laced up classic Jordan Brand models with a few being worn by Byron Wesley, Dewayne Dedmon, and J.T. Terrell. Wesley laced up the "Flu Game" Air Jordan XII, Dedmon took to the court in the "Last Shot" Air Jordan XIV, and J.T. Terrell wore the "Bordeaux" Air Jordan VII.
